White-label ERP providers operate in one of the most compliance-sensitive segments of enterprise technology. Whether serving distribution, manufacturing, construction, retail, or professional services, ERP systems manage financial data, operational workflows, payroll, inventory, procurement, and customer records. Adding AI automation into the ERP layer introduces powerful efficiency gains—but also complex compliance responsibilities.
For ERP providers, system integrators, and SaaS startups embedding automation into their products, compliance is no longer just a legal requirement. It is a competitive differentiator. When AI agents and automation workflows are introduced into ERP systems, every automated action must be auditable, secure, and policy-controlled. A poorly implemented AI integration can expose sensitive financial records, automate non-compliant approvals, or create untraceable decision chains.
Traditional ERP extensions were not designed for modern AI agents or generative systems. This is where a modern White-Label AI Automation SaaS platform becomes essential—providing structured governance, secure private GPT deployment, and enterprise-grade workflow orchestration.
Compliance-first AI automation requires a layered implementation strategy:
| Layer | Compliance Focus |
|---|---|
| Infrastructure | Private cloud, data residency control, encrypted storage |
| Workflow Engine (n8n) | Auditable automation flows, version control, access restrictions |
| AI Agents | Role-scoped data access, decision logging, approval checkpoints |
| Private GPT Systems | RAG-based knowledge control, no external data leakage |
| API Orchestration | Secure authentication, rate limits, encrypted communication |
